What Would Influence a Hypothetical Lorna Shore Stock Quote?
Several factors would contribute to the perceived value of a fictional Lorna Shore stock, mirroring the dynamics of any publicly traded company, but with a unique metal twist:
1. Album Sales and Streaming Revenue: The Foundation of Success
Just like any publicly traded company relies on its core product, a band's financial success hinges on album sales and streaming revenue. Strong album sales, high streaming numbers on platforms like Spotify and Apple Music, and successful merchandise sales would all positively affect a hypothetical Lorna Shore stock quote. Consistent chart performance and critical acclaim would further bolster investor confidence.
2. Touring and Live Performances: The Engine of Growth
Live performances are crucial for any band. Successful concert tours, high ticket sales, and sold-out venues are key indicators of a band's popularity and financial stability. A robust touring schedule and consistently high attendance at concerts would reflect favorably on a hypothetical Lorna Shore stock price.
3. Brand Partnerships and Sponsorships: Expanding the Reach
Strategic brand partnerships and sponsorships can significantly impact a band's revenue and overall image. Collaborations with relevant brands, endorsements, and licensing deals could positively influence the perceived value of a Lorna Shore stock.
4. Fan Engagement and Social Media Presence: Building the Community
In today's digital age, fan engagement is paramount. A strong and active online presence, high social media engagement, and a dedicated fanbase would all contribute to a positive outlook on a fictional Lorna Shore stock. Successful interaction with fans and effective community building are vital.
5. Management and Leadership: Guiding the Vision
The band's management team plays a pivotal role in guiding the band's financial success and public image. Strong leadership, effective decision-making, and strategic planning would significantly influence investor confidence and the hypothetical Lorna Shore stock quote.
6. Industry Trends and Competition: Navigating the Metal Landscape
The metal music industry is constantly evolving. Changes in listening habits, the rise of new subgenres, and the success of competing bands all impact the overall market. A band's ability to adapt to these trends and maintain a competitive edge is essential for maintaining a strong stock price.
